Safe-Lock WD-40 Lubricant Valve for Training Workshops and Student Use with Child-Resistant Mechanism
Foster a safe and effective learning environment with our Safe-Lock WD-40 Lubricant Valve, specifically designed for vocational schools, technical colleges, and training workshops. Safety is the core principle of this valve's design, featuring an intuitive but effective child-resistant locking mechanism that requires a specific "push-and-turn" action to activate. This prevents accidental discharge by inexperienced users while remaining easy for instructed students and professionals to operate.
The valve also produces a consistent, predictable spray pattern, which is essential for teaching proper lubrication techniques—from applying a light protective coating to using a penetrant on a practice project. Its bright, highly visible color makes it easy for instructors to identify and monitor usage. Frequently Asked Questions
Q: How does the child-resistant lock work?
A: To spray, the user must firmly push the actuator down and simultaneously rotate it to a specific position, a two-step action that is difficult for young children but simple for trained individuals.
